From 5bd5161152e3b86071243f85a98d3de5cf16f5d1 Mon Sep 17 00:00:00 2001 From: guoqibing Date: Wed, 26 Nov 2025 09:51:25 +0800 Subject: [PATCH] =?UTF-8?q?=E6=B5=8B=E8=AF=95?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- Jenkinsfile | 38 ++++++++++++-------------------------- 1 file changed, 12 insertions(+), 26 deletions(-) diff --git a/Jenkinsfile b/Jenkinsfile index 1578847..a09b710 100644 --- a/Jenkinsfile +++ b/Jenkinsfile @@ -2,9 +2,20 @@ pipeline { /* 声明式流水线内容 */ agent any + tools { + //maven 'maven-3.9.9' + } + + // agent { + // docker { + // image 'maven:3-alpine' + // label 'my-defined-label' + // args '-v /tmp:/tmp' + // } + //} + stages { stage('打包jar..........') { - steps { echo '打包中...' sh 'pwd' @@ -12,28 +23,6 @@ pipeline { sh '/apache-maven-3.9.11/bin/mvn -version' sh '/apache-maven-3.9.11/bin/mvn clean package' echo '打包Success...' - } - - //steps { - // echo '打包中...' - // //sh 'pwd' - // echo 'maven-start...' - // //sh '/apache-maven-3.9.11/bin/mvn -version' - // //sh '/apache-maven-3.9.11/bin/mvn clean package' - // echo 'maven-end...' - // //sh 'cp ${PATH}/target/*.jar .' - // echo '打包Success...' - // - //} - } - stage('docker-Build') { - steps { - sh 'docker build -f ${PATH}/Dockerfile -t ${PROJECT_NAME}:${VERSION} .' - } - } - stage('docker-start') { - steps { - sh 'docker-compose up -d ${PROJECT_NAME}' } } } @@ -51,8 +40,5 @@ pipeline { //环境变量 environment { MODULE_PATH = 'fly-home-common' - PROJECT_NAME = 'flyhome-order' - VERSION = '2.4.1' - PATH= 'fly-home-order/fly-home-order-server' } } \ No newline at end of file